Java各版本JDK下载指南:Java 1.8、Java 15与Java 18对比
需积分: 50 149 浏览量
更新于2024-10-17
收藏 510.9MB RAR 举报
资源摘要信息:"Java是一种广泛使用的计算机编程语言,以其“一次编写,到处运行”的特性而闻名。Java版本的演进经历了多个阶段,从最初的Java 1.0开始,经历了多个更新和迭代,直至目前的最新版本。Java的开发工具包(JDK)是Java开发中不可或缺的一部分,它为Java程序员提供了开发Java应用程序所需的工具。标题中提到的“java1.8”、“java18.0”和“java15”指的是Java的不同版本,而“jdk-8u181-windows-x64.exe”、“jdk-18_windows-x64_bin.exe”和“jdk-15.0.1_windows-x64_bin.exe”是这些版本对应的JDK安装文件的名称。这些文件分别对应Java 8 Update 181、Java 18和Java 15.0.1版本的64位Windows安装包。在JDK的命名规则中,版本号通常由一个主版本号、一个次版本号和一个更新号组成。例如,在“jdk-8u181-windows-x64.exe”中,‘8’代表Java的主要版本号8,‘u’代表更新(update),‘181’是这次更新的更新号。JDK文件通常包含Java运行时环境(JRE)和Java虚拟机(JVM),以及其他开发工具如编译器(javac)和文档生成工具(javadoc)。
Java 1.8(即Java 8)是较为早期的一个长期支持(LTS)版本,发布于2014年3月,它引入了诸如Lambda表达式、Stream API、新的日期时间API等重要特性。Java 15于2020年9月发布,虽然不是长期支持版本,但同样带来了一些新特性,例如记录类型(record)和模式匹配的预览特性。Java 18尚未正式发布,但根据Oracle的版本计划,可以预见它将带来新的功能和改进。
在Java的版本管理中,Oracle为特定版本的JDK提供了不同长度的支持周期。长期支持版本会得到更长时间的技术支持和安全更新,而非长期支持版本则通常在发布六个月后就不再提供公开更新。因此,在选择安装和使用哪个版本的JDK时,需要根据项目的需要和对支持周期的考虑来决定。企业级应用往往倾向于使用LTS版本,以确保稳定性与安全性。
JDK安装文件的名称列表显示了三个不同版本的JDK,分别适用于Windows系统的64位处理器架构。文件名中的“windows-x64”表明了这些JDK是为64位Windows操作系统设计的。'bin'表示文件是二进制执行文件,用于在目标系统上安装和运行JDK。而“jdk-8u181”、“jdk-18”和“jdk-15.0.1”分别指明了安装包对应的JDK版本和更新号。"
【关键词】: Java, JDK, JDK安装包, Java版本管理, Windows-x64,长期支持版本, 非长期支持版本, Lambda表达式, Stream API, 记录类型, 模式匹配, 64位处理器架构。
2021-05-22 上传
2022-08-20 上传
2022-06-01 上传
2022-09-28 上传
2024-09-07 上传
2023-09-25 上传
2022-06-25 上传
袁哥大话安全
- 粉丝: 46
- 资源: 8
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程